3) Jeopardy Masters (ABC/Hulu)
English Audio Description?: Yes
Status: Not Yet Renewed
Night one has Andrew in the lead, which is hilarious since I think he was a wildcard for the Tournament of Champions. On an audio description note, I know Ken was talking, but the only thing the audio description really does is reveal where the Daily Doubles are. That’s basically it. So, in the second game, for double Jeopardy, when it didn’t do that… I assumed the narrator fell asleep. There’s almost no audio description, so it’s pretty noticeable.
Episode Grade: A-
